The Secret of Sustainable Chemistry: A New Era with Carbon

Markus Antonietti Receives Arkema Award from the French Academy of Sciences

The prestigious award, valued at EUR 25,000, honours Prof. Markus Antonietti's groundbreaking research in carbon catalysis. Antonietti develops materials with special properties for more sustainable chemical syntheses: carbon materials are abundant in nature, consume less energy than metal catalysts, and are reusable. The same Academy once hosted Antoine Lavoisier, known as the father of modern chemistry, who was also fascinated by carbon's versatility.

The French Academy of Sciences has proudly promoted the advancement of science since 1666—when founded by the Sun King, the name reflected the patronage attributed to him. Today this tradition continues to honour extraordinary researchers across various disciplines. Among the 2024 award recipients, chemist Markus Antonietti received the prestigious Arkema Award, valued at EUR 25,000, for his contributions to sustainable transformation reactions through carbon catalysis.

In brief, carbon catalysis develops carbon-based materials to make chemical reactions faster, more cost-effective and more precisely tunable. This can be thought of as primitive versions of enzymes made from biological molecules, but without biology: "I call this the black magic of carbon catalysis" – says Prof. Markus Antonietti, director of the Department of Colloid Chemistry at MPICI since 1993. Black carbon powders can replace rare metals such as platinum and iridium in catalysts. Carbons produced at very low cost from renewable sources, based on sustainable sources, undoubtedly contribute to greener chemistry and the reactions they support consume less energy. For example, Antonietti's research simplifies the splitting of water into hydrogen and oxygen and the conversion of CO2 into various valuable molecules using only water and electricity.

Behind this black magic with an apparently green horizon lies a lifetime of dedication, continuous intellectual exchange and creativity. This is what the Academy honours in Antonietti today, making him a name following in the footsteps of many renowned scientists.

The building where the award is presented has weathered at least two revolutions: the revolution that began with the storming of the Bastille in 1789 and the scientific revolution initiated by Antoine Lavoisier's *Traité élémentaire de chimie* published that same year. A member of the Academy, Lavoisier redefined chemistry through experimental rigour and keen curiosity. He once dared to burn diamonds to prove their carbon structure.

Two centuries later, Antonietti keeps this spirit alive by shaping tomorrow's chemical reactions using one of nature's most abundant elements.
